What is Black Stainless 1/4-20?
The term 1/4-20 refers to the size and thread count of the fastener. Specifically:
- 1/4-inch diameter: The bolt has a diameter of 1/4 inch.
- 20 threads per inch (TPI): The bolt features 20 threads per inch, providing strong, secure fastening.
The "black stainless" aspect refers to the material and finish of the bolt. Black stainless steel is a variant of regular stainless steel that has been treated to provide a sleek, dark appearance, often through a process like powder coating or electroplating. This finish not only gives the fastener a modern look but also enhances its durability by providing an additional layer of protection against corrosion and wear.

How to Choose the Right Black Stainless 1/4-20 Bolt
When selecting the best black stainless 1/4-20 bolt for your project, consider the following factors:
-
Thread Length: Ensure the thread length is sufficient for your specific application. The bolt should have enough thread engagement to provide secure fastening.
-
Grade of Stainless Steel: Stainless steel comes in various grades, with 304 and 316 being the most common. For marine or outdoor applications, 316 stainless steel offers superior corrosion resistance.
-
Black Coating Type: The black finish can be applied in different ways, including powder coating or electroplating. Choose the type of finish that best suits your environment and aesthetic preferences.
